Many people don't realize just how much behind the scenes work there is for Leonid and Irina and how hard they work to keep PS shill-free. It takes countless hours of moderating and checking into things and it's a full-time job now that PS has grown to be the size it is. So it's actually somewhat offensive to them (from my perspective) when people keep insinuating that there are shills here. There has been serious drama in the past when shills were outed and banned and it has not only been one instance. People figure it out eventually. No one is 'scoffing' about the idea of shills...but PS is about as shill-free as I think almost any online forum or board can be...and it's not just by luck, it's through the hard work of Leonid and Irina.

To give you an idea of how easy it can be:

back in the young days of the net, in 1997 I was an ircop (think administratior) on one of the largest family oriented irc networks on the net.
We had an irc channel called girlchat where a bunch of teenage girls from all around the world hung out.
That tended to attract a lot of pervs so the ircops knew most of the members of the channel from dealing with idiots who gave them a hard time.

On day a perv started sending nasty messages to one of them and she notified me about it.
I got his ip/isp info and de-oped, changed nicks and contacted.
From the nick he thought I was a girl and starts up his gross comments.

In the meantime im checking his internet information out.
Turns out he is coming in from a major company in Utah that if I named them you would know who it is.
I called the number on their website and talked to the receptionist who transfered me to the IT department.
They tracked it back to one computer there and got the guys boss in a conference call.
I read his boss some of the stuff he was saying and the IT guy was doing packet captures for evidence.
His boos said ill be right back and went and got him, sneaking up and seeing him typing in the irc client.
He picked up the phone and I said this is -nickname- you are so busted!

Total time from me contacting him online and him getting fired 3 min and 32 seconds.
